On Monday, the temperature was 40°F. On Tuesday, the temperature increased 3°F. On Wednesday, the temperature decreased 15°F. Wh

at integer represents the overall change in temperature from Monday to Wednesday?
Mathematics
1 answer:
Fantom [35]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:The answer is - 12 because the temperature started changing when it raised 3+ and then it changed again by dropping -15 so, then you do 3-15 and that equals (-12).

Four consecutive odd integers add up to 288. which integers are they?
murzikaleks [220]
Let the smallest integer be x
x + (x+2) + (x+4) + (x+6) = 288
4x +12 =288
4x= 276
x = 69
The integers are 69, 71, 73 and 75
